Lineage Statement |
Canopy Height Models (CHMs) were produced from LiDAR point cloud data for all available LiDAR projects and represent the distance between the ground and above ground objects. This includes the height of trees, buildings and any other objects on the ground surface. Each CHM was output at a 2-metre sample spacing and mosaicked together to show the most current data as a single raster dataset. |
||||
Lineage Description |
Positional Accuracy: The Tree Canopy Height layer is compiled from a number of LiDAR projects and as such, accuracy and currency vary according to source.
Refer to LiDAR indexes for individual LiDAR project specifications.
